Dexa scan and osteopenia

2025-03-05 02:11:18
Hi, i got dexa scan as part of my whole body check up in march 2024. It showed tscore of -1.5 and -1.8 at femur neck and femur total. Tscore of spine was -0.5. that time doctor told me to take calcium shelcal and vitamin B12 and said nothing is serious. My vitamin D was normal. I now have some backpain, leg pain at times from hips. Got physiotherapy done and it got better but returns if i stop exercise. My body joints feel stiff sometimes and have neck pain and knee pain with activities too.I'm concerned if my osteopenia progressed too soon. Should i get dexa scan done again? I'm only 29 F now. Please guide me. I'm scared if i got osteoporosis or osteopenia worsened. Thank you!

Hello.The back pain might be due to a variety of reasons including prolonged sitting.The Osteopenia usually does not progress this fast. The neck and knee pain might be due lack of exercise and stiffness.
Next Steps
I don't feel there is a need to repeat DEXA scan. You do need a few more blood tests though.
Health Tips
You should continue exercises for your back. Avoid prolonged sitting and forward bending. Please consult a doctor for better evaluation and treatment plan.
